Output bd59c7a1480cd90c3168c08af00662030741c015ca432e4dc811c6a2317957e6:19

value
67497821
script pubkey
OP_0 OP_PUSHBYTES_32 a93a612326592d320d2558407447269ef680b487bc7462c163b78492ce881f25
address
bc1q4yaxzgextyknyrf9tpq8g3exnmmgpdy8h36x9strk7zf9n5grujsp52cnv
transaction
bd59c7a1480cd90c3168c08af00662030741c015ca432e4dc811c6a2317957e6